Program areas at Project Bike Tech
Bike Tech in School: (1) Project Bike Tech (PBT) has served more than 3800 students over the last 16 years. In 2023, PBT expanded and added 4 new schools to reach approximately 1100 students each year. (2) The PBT in schools program provides the curriculum to better prepare students with career technical education, pathways, and content. PBT continually improves the course content to help make students job-ready in the bicycle industry and in other careers where an understanding of engineering and mathematics is essential to career development. (3) PBT has successfully established and maintained bicycle education programs for students in Santa Cruz County CA schools and 4 new schools. The program offers students a CTE course of study to help prepare them for college and their future career while also exposing them to a positive bicycle culture and the ideas for community stewardship (for example, share the road knowledge and trail building skills). PBT advocates green careers.
EXPANSION: Level 2 and eBike curriculum; apprenticeships, internships, and approved curriculum development. Expanding to middle schools,jr colleges and penal institutions - creating pathways all while expanding the bike tech classes to new schools nationwide.

Financials for Project Bike Tech
Revenues | FYE 12/2023 | FYE 12/2022 | % Change |
---|
Total grants, contributions, etc. | $192,547 | $285,780 | -32.6% |
Program services | $387,508 | $366,467 | 5.7% |
